用VB向WPS工作表中添加数据

来源:百度知道 编辑:UC知道 时间:2024/06/11 17:53:43
问下各位,WPS表中A1=日期 B1=时间.在VB中有两个TEXTBOX,一个是,T1,一个是T2 ,还有一个COMMAND按键,我想在T1和T2中输入数据后,点击COMMAND时就把T1存到A2中,T2存到B2中,以此来推,以后一直往A3,B3 A4,B4 A5,B5.....中存入T1,T2的数据...我想了好久了,麻烦VB的高手们指点下!!小弟万分感谢!!!
HH 其实当表一直处在打开的状态下对他实现象我说的并不是太难...我刚才才想起:如果我录入到一半就不想录入了呢,我会把表关了,那么下次再对这个表录入时先前的数据就会没有了,我这个想法难就难在没办法知道打开表时(或可以不打开表),哪个An,Bn是没有数据的,也就是说:每次重新给表添加新数据时都要在往最后一个....这点好难,实在想不通.....0_0

呵呵,以前还从来没有遇见过WPS的VBA呢,新鲜!研究了一下,给你成功的做出来了,代码如下。
====================
Dim i As Integer
Dim ET As Object, sht As Object
Private Sub Command1_Click()
i = i + 1
sht.Cells(i, 1).Value = Text1.Text
sht.Cells(i, 2).Value = Text2.Text
End Sub

Private Sub Form_Load()
Set ET = CreateObject("et.application")
Set sht = ET.Workbooks.Add.Sheets("sheet1")
ET.Visible = True

End Sub

  1、打开WPS表格程序,切换到“开发工具”选项卡,点击“说明”按钮,此时将打开说明窗口。

如何用VB实现向表中添加随机数据 vb向access中如何添加新的数据?????? 无法向表中添加数据(触发器) VB向数据库添加数据(有代码) 如何向vb MSFlexGrid控件添加数据? 如何向SQL Server2000表中添加数据??? 用ASP向数据库(ACCESS)中添加数据 VB中如何实现数据的添加。 asp中怎样向多个表添加数据 不能向网站数据库中添加数据